Output f88afbcaa15aa7176bcb34361712394286713b90f45940044b440788d18ca968:78

value
26455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df722d782b0e03e0fb18ab27566bc95c54bfca43 OP_EQUAL
address
3N4VPXDEzcKBptCaVVrR2FGoajujgQuRuQ
transaction
f88afbcaa15aa7176bcb34361712394286713b90f45940044b440788d18ca968
spent
true